NOVATOP SOLID for walls and crossbars

Description
NOVATOP SOLID – is large format multi-layer panel type CLT (cross-laminated timber). Each layer is consisted by plates made of solid wood and fiber orientation of each layer is always at right angles to adjacent layers. Slats in each layer are bonded in the longitudinal and transverse direction and the layers are glued to each other.

Basic standard formats:
6000 x 2500
6000 x 2100
5000 x 2500
5000 x 2100 (max. 12000 x 2950 mm)

The other formats are based on those basic formats.

Thickness:
For walls: 62, 84 (42/42), 124 (62/62) mm
For roofs and ceilings : 81 (27/27/27), 84 (42/42), 116 (27/62/27) mm

Quality:
Visible, construction (no-visible)

Applications:
structural and non-bearing walls, partitions, ceilings and roof materials, solid roof and floor slabs, reinforcing components.

NOVATOP ELEMENTS for roofs and ceilings

NOVATOP ELEMENTS are large ribbed components made from multi-layer solid panels. The structure of the element is composed of a supporting base multi-layer panels, whose thickness depends on the required fire resistance design. On it, are glued on the transverse and longitudinal ribs, whose height is dependent on the load of the element. The whole structure is enclosed upper multi-layer panels. Elements are variable in terms of latitude, longitude and height, the cavity between the ribs can be planted as required by the construction of thermal, acoustic and fire isolation.

New: NOVATOP ELEMENTS OPEN
Description: The design element is formed by supporting the lower multi-layer panels. The KVH prism are stuck on it in the longitudinal direction and along the perimeter. According to the requirements of statics are dimensions and spacing of these beams, which form the carrier part. These elements are suitable for roof construction.

Standard width:
690, 1030, 2090, 2450, max 2450 mm

Length:
Length are arbitrarily selectable according to the project documentation, standardly 6000 max. 12000 mm.

Standard height:
160, 180, 200, 220, 240, 280, 300, 320, max. 400 mm

Quality:
Visible, construction (no-visible)

Applications:
Roofs and ceilings

NOVATOP STATIC for roof overhangs

STATIC NOVATOP are large multi-layer panels with two parallel upper layers from each side and the middle layer with fibers perpendicular to the course of the fiber surface layers (SWP – Solid wood panel). Each layer is composed of panels made of solid wood, the thickness of the layers can be different and they determinate the final thickness of the plate.

NOVATOP STATIC L (Bending strength parallel to grain flow in surface layers)

Standard length:
2500, 5000, 6000 mm
Max. length up to 12000 mm (by tinned join)
Standard width:
1040, 1250, 2100, 2500 mm

NOVATOP STATIC Q ( (Bending strength perpendicular to grain flow in surface layers)

Standard length:
4 950 mm (by tinned join)
Max. length up to 12000 mm
Standard width:
2500 mm

Standard thiskness:
45, 60 mm

Quality:
Visible, construction (no-visible)

Applications:
Structure of overhanging edges of roofs, staircase lining, steps and landing, facings exposed to increased bearing capacity (walls, ceilings, roofs), supporting panels of external walls, load carrying/non-carrying panels of interior walls partition walls, constructions protected against earthquakes, facings, meeting requirements for fire resistance, doors and gates, racks, meeting uncommon requirements, regarding their loading capacity and stability, working platforms and scaffolding, covers protecting shafts and ducts, walls and roofs of parking sheds, structure of containers…
